Nancy Steineke in her book REading & Writing Together has a reading log that has to be signed by a parent stating that the student has discussed the book with him/her. I love it. They get to read a book of their choice, but have to stay with one book. It's a great way to give homework credit. Some parents have said it's the only time their sons have talked to them about school.
